Sometime after 8:31pm PST on 7 February, tweets from my Twitter account stopped automatically posting to Facebook. Nothing seemed to have changed, so trying to fix the problem was troublesome. I finally figured it out, so here are step-by-step instructions on getting your tweets back onto Facebook:

1. Go to the Twitter app page on Facebook. If you have previously allowed Twitter to paste to your Wall, you’ll see a checkbox next to “Facebook Profile”. Uncheck it. If the little spinny circle doesn’t go away, refresh the page and ensure it’s unchecked.
2. Send a tweet.
3. Check the “Facebook Profile” box. Again, if necessary, refresh the page to ensure the box is checked.
4. Send another tweet. This tweet (but not the previous one) should show up on Facebook.

Update for 15 February: It would appear that things have gone south again and these instructions no longer work. I’ll try to figure out another solution. Or, if you have another solution, feel free to post it in the comments below!

Update for 16 February: It would appear that things have got back to their “normal” state of breaking and working again, so these instructions should work! Isn’t Facebook fun?
